Sump pump installation services involve setting up a device designed to remove excess water from the basement or crawl space of a property. The process typically includes selecting an appropriate sump pump, installing it in a designated sump basin, and connecting it to the property's drainage system. These systems are essential for managing water intrusion,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high groundwater levels. Professional contractors ensure the sump pump is properly positioned and wired, providing a reliable solution to prevent water accumulation and protect the property's foundation.

The overview below groups typical Sump Pump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Meridian,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ine sump pump repairs or adjustments typically range from $150 to $400. These projects often involve fixing or replacing small parts and are common among local contractors. Costs generally stay within this lower to mid-range band for standard service calls.
Full Sump Pump Replacement - Replacing an entire sump pump system usually costs between $400 and $1,200, depending on the pump model and installation complexity. Many homeowners opt for mid-tier models, which fall into this typical range, while higher-end systems can push costs higher.
Installing a New Sump Pump System - Installing a new sump pump and basin can range from $1,000 to $3,000 for most residential projects. Larger or more complex installations, such as those requiring additional drainage work, may reach $4,000 or more, though these are less common.
Advanced or Custom Drainage Solutions - For specialized systems like battery backups or custom drainage, costs can start around $2,500 and go beyond $5,000. These higher-tier projects are less frequent but may be necessary for homes with specific needs or challenging site con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a sump pump and why is it important? A sump pump is a device that helps remove excess water from a basement or crawl space, preventing flooding and water damage. Local contractors can install a sump pump to help protect properties during heavy rain or groundwater buildup.
How do I know if my home needs a sump pump? Signs that a sump pump may be needed include frequent basement flooding, damp or wet basement areas, or water pooling during storms. Service providers in the area can assess the property and recommend suitable solutions.
What types of sump pumps are available for installation? There are various types of sump pumps, including submersible and pedestal models. Local contractors can help determine which type best fits the specific needs of a property in Meridian, ID.
What factors influence the installation process of a sump pump? Factors include the size of the area to be protected, the sump pump's capacity, and the existing drainage setup. Experienced service providers can handle the installation tailored to the property's requirements.
How can I ensure my sump pump functions properly after installation? Regular maintenance such as testing the pump, cleaning the basin, and inspecting the discharge pipe helps ensure proper operation. Local pros can provide guidance or maintenance services to keep the system working effectively.
